    Accommodation Details

    Gas central heating with gas fire. Electric oven, gas hob, microwave, fridge, freezer, washing machine, dishwasher. TV with Sky Q in living room, Netfilx, music streaming via Spotify and Sky Q Bluetooth, WiFi, selection of books and games. Bed linen and towels inc. in rent. Fuel and power inc. in rent. Off-road parking for 3 cars on an extensive private driveway with secure bike storage point. Enclosed rear garden with generous lawn and outside eating area as well as a further raised shale gravel area with seating to watch the sunset and sunrise, The access to the rear garden and eating area can be gained via both the garden gate as well as the lounge patio door. Sorry, no smoking or pets allowed. Shop and pub within 10-minute walk with . Note: This Property has the added benefit of an electric car charging station. Note: The property may not be suitable for guests with a sensory impairment and/or physical disability due to its internal layout and also access/egress constraints via steps. Note: Direct USB charging in the kitchen and main bedroom

    More Information

    Sea Roke is a detached bungalow settled into the wonderful seaside resort of Filey. This light and airy dwelling, situated within a Victorian-style resort, is perfect for friends and families looking to escape to the North East and Yorkshire Coast. Completed with a quality touch, the cottage offers three well-presented bedrooms, comprising of a super-king-size (zip/link can be twin on request), a king-size bed and a single bed, ensuring a flexible sleeping arrangement to suit the needs of your family. Moving through the property, you will find a streamlined kitchen which is perfect for rustling up some tasty treats before unwinding of an evening within the sitting room, where you can enjoy your favourite film on Sky Q or Netflix, whilst keeping toasty and warm in front of the gas fire. With a 55″ HD Smart Android TV, superfast WiFi and DAB radio, guests will have plenty of choice for a quiet night in, if they can tear themselves away from watching wide scenic views from the living room and kitchen. Completing the ground-floor property is a family bathroom, offering a recently refurbished modern bathroom suite with large corner shower, basin and WC. Open up the patio doors to discover an enclosed garden area, where the children can enjoy the lawn area whilst you enjoy a refreshing beverage upon the elevated gravelled sitting area, perfect for enjoying the surrounding countryside views. The cottage boasts unique stunning panoramic views across protected land over just 2 fields to the magnificent east coast and with direct access to the Cleveland Way, a popular spot for a late evening summers walk to the Brigg or an airy stroll with different views whichever way you turn. A five minute walk brings you to the town centre, where there is a variety of tea rooms, 12 pubs and bars and independent shops, whilst a ten minute walk brings you to the seafront. Enjoy a stroll along the promenade with its brightly coloured beach huts, ornamental gardens and cafés or build sandcastles on the wonderful, long sandy beach, where you can walk for miles. Your local shop and pub is only a seven minute walk away and there are many activities for the family to be getting involved with, from pony rides on the beach to crazy golf. If you fancy an exciting cliff walk and to do a bit of bird spotting, Flamborough Head and Bempton RSPB Reserve is well worth a visit to see the puffins and kittiwakes both nearby. Alternatively, venture out to Scarborough, Britain’s first seaside resort, where younger guests will be delighted with the SEA LIFE Sanctuary and Alpamare water park, Scarborough Castle, the open air theatre for concerts, the South Cliff Gardens and the North Yorkshire Water Park each offering a superb day out. If you’re looking for a leisurely day out, how about visiting the elegant promenades of bright and breezy Bridlington? With its sandy beaches, award-winning promenades and historic harbour, this is a hidden seaside gem awash with kitsch traditional entertainment. Visit the funfair, amusements and donkey rides on the beach for a traditional British day out with seaside in spades. Make Sea Roke your traditional seaside holiday base.
